Output fbf54a9a062e52eaa6d9eee361ca5b4a1f7549fbf08ecf87d6ea664b8b41ea75:26

value
98865910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 583f8e7445e6a260d83288a0451e60028df2caeb OP_EQUAL
address
39jdXQTNDKqh6yCzv68kjNgzD63ycuD3w9
transaction
fbf54a9a062e52eaa6d9eee361ca5b4a1f7549fbf08ecf87d6ea664b8b41ea75
spent
true